UPDATE (5.01pm):
Traffic flow has returned to normal following a serious crash at Faulconbridge on Monday afternoon.
A two-car accident occurred at about 3.15pm on the Great Western Highway, near Faulconbridge train station.
Eastbound traffic were affected for up to 90 minutes following the incident.
All eastbound lanes were closed for some time to allow for a vehicle salvage operation to take place.
However, the site has now been cleared and all lanes have re-opened.
